    Jordan was ROY and an all-star his rookie year. He didn't make it past the first round because he was going up against stacked veteran teams and had no help and Jordan was averaging 37 points at 23 and was an MVP the year after.

    There is no way to twist it, Jordan needed help, got it, then went on to win championships.

    It should be stated guys like Jordan, Lebron...Wemby...these are exceptions, these guys come into the NBA and dominate. Most players to get into their prime at 25, so Jalen does have that going for him. But Jordan is the wrong guy to mention, you could have put Jalen Brunson in there or hell Curry.

    Curry wasn't much at 23, an of injured player that could hit a few threes. Nash didn't hit his prime until 27.

    So you do make a good point but Jordan is not the guy you want to throw in there for that.

    But there should be a leap of maturity for Jalen next year if he's here. Signs of growth. While Jalen definitely has improved his playmaking and defense, we didn't draft him for that quite frankly.
